Resumo:On a daily basis, several violations of women's human rights are verified, whether in the public or domestic environment, in all countries around the world, given the different proportions and specificities, a reflection of a historical process of inferiorization and socio-political exclusion through which this group has passed. In this context, inter-American feminism emerged in order to combat the serious violations of rights that threaten the lives and dignity of women, especially in Latin America. Thus, the question is: what does inter-american feminism consist of and what are its contributions to the realization of women's human rights in Brazil? In order to answer this question, the main purpose of this course conclusion work is to analyze the international protection of women's human rights and its consequences in Brazil. To this end, a study will be carried out on inter-American feminism, as well as its contributions to the Brazilian State, with regard to the protection of the human rights of this vulnerable social group. In this way, a bibliographic review will be carried out on the subject, based on the gender perspective, in addition to a documentary analysis of regulations and manifestations of the Inter-American System for the Protection of Human Rights on the subject. Finally, Brazilian legislation, decisions and initiatives will be explored, protecting women, motivated/influenced by inter-american feminism. Therefore, it’s a qualitative and descriptive research, with regard to the approach, and exploratory and explanatory, in relation to the achievement of objectives, through the deductive method. This research is justified by the social relevance and topicality of the theme and resulted in the realization that inter-American feminism has brought and continues to bring numerous contributions to the realization of the human rights of Brazilian women, such as the Maria da Penha Law and Recommendation nº 128 of the National Council Justice. It remains for their standards to be more/better developed in the country.
